The family of a Democratic National Committee(DNC) staffer who was murdered in Washington, D.C., in July asked the public for help finding their son’s killer, after nearly four weeks without authorities identifying a suspect.
Officers with the Metropolitan Police Department (MPD) joined the family of Seth Rich, 27, who died July 10 from gunshot wounds walking to his home in northwest D.C., in a press conference Thursday. The Rich family requested that people come forward with any information that may lead to an arrest of the killer, reports WJLA.
Rich was on the phone with his girlfriend when the assailant attacked him.
